Knighs & Horses
A great value, this set comes with four knights and their four steeds 1. Templar Knight (red cross) with white beard & white horse 2. Knight of the Kingdom of Jerusalem (red cross with four smaller red crosses around it) with brown beard and white horse 3. Hospitaller Knight (white cross on black ground) with black beard and brown horse 4. Teutonic Knight (black cross on white ground) with brown beard and brown horse Each figure comes with helmet, flag, flagpole, sword, cape, extra hand, 3x4 base with 1 row of studs. Each horse comes a 4x6 base, a tabard skirt for its rider, and barding in 4 parts: shaffron (headpiece), crinet (neckpiece), peytral (chestpiece), and caparison (fabric over the rump, including the built-in saddle). The barding pieces hold together mostly by grip, but if you put the peytral on last it will lock things in place a bit; note that the horse needs to be in the "basic" pose, all four hooves down, and head up, for the barding to fit. Speaking of fit, the capes are very snug around the neck posts (probably because there are two layers of paint, silver and tan, over the plastic). An easy fix is to put the cape on upside down, which allows you to rotate it back and forth, wearing off some of the excess paint until it loosens up. Then you can put it back on the right way and top it with the minifigure's head. With al the different layers and pieces involved, it can be a bit unwieldy once the knight is in the saddle, but there's no denying they make for an impressive sight!
